**宝塔面板如何配置SSH密钥登录:全面指南**,本文将为您详细解读如何在宝塔面板中配置SSH密钥登录,您需要生成SSH密钥对并添加到宝塔面板,在面板设置中配置SSH公钥,并启用密码验证或密钥验证,完成这些步骤后,您即可通过SSH密钥登录宝塔面板,享受更安全的访问体验,配置过程简单易懂,适合各类用户,掌握此技巧,让您的服务器更加安全、高效。
在当今的数字化时代,安全可靠的远程访问变得尤为重要,宝塔面板作为一款功能强大的服务器管理工具,为我们提供了便捷的服务器管理方案,SSH密钥登录作为一种安全、高效的访问方式,受到了广泛应用,本文将详细介绍如何在宝塔面板中配置SSH密钥登录,帮助用户轻松实现安全、稳定的远程访问。
SSH密钥登录原理
SSH(Secure Shell)是一种加密的网络传输协议,它使用公钥加密技术来实现安全的数据传输,通过SSH密钥登录,用户可以在不输入密码的情况下,直接通过服务器的公钥验证身份,从而实现安全的远程访问。
宝塔面板配置SSH密钥登录步骤
-
生成SSH密钥对
在本地计算机上打开终端,执行以下命令生成SSH密钥对:
ssh-keygen -t rsa -C "your_email@example.com"
这将在本地计算机上生成一个名为
id_rsa的私钥文件和一个名为id_rsa.pub的公钥文件,私钥文件需要妥善保管,切勿泄露给他人。 -
将公钥上传至宝塔面板
使用FTP或宝塔面板的文件管理器,将生成的公钥文件(
id_rsa.pub)上传至宝塔面板的远程服务器中,将公钥文件上传至服务器的/www/server/目录下的ssh Keys文件夹中是一个不错的选择。 -
在宝塔面板中配置SSH密钥登录
登录宝塔面板后,在左侧导航栏中选择“安全”,然后点击“SSH 配置”,在SSH配置页面中,点击“新增”按钮,填写以下信息:
- 私钥文件路径:填入刚才上传的私钥文件路径,例如
/www/server/ssh Keys/id_rsa。 - 用户名:填入需要登录的用户名,例如
root。 - :勾选刚刚上传的公钥文件,系统会自动加载公钥内容。
点击“保存”按钮即可完成配置。
- 私钥文件路径:填入刚才上传的私钥文件路径,例如
-
测试SSH密钥登录
重新登录宝塔面板或使用其他SSH客户端连接到服务器,尝试使用私钥进行身份验证,如果一切正常,您将不再需要输入密码,直接登录到服务器。
注意事项
- 请确保私钥文件的权限设置正确,通常建议设置为
600(只有所有者可以读写)。 - 公钥文件需谨慎保管,避免泄露给他人。
- 若长时间不使用SSH密钥登录,可以考虑将公钥文件从服务器上删除,以降低安全风险。
通过本文的介绍,相信您已经学会了如何在宝塔面板中配置SSH密钥登录,这种方式不仅方便快捷,而且安全性高,适用于各种场景下的远程访问需求,希望本文能为您的服务器安全管理提供有益的参考和帮助。


还没有评论,来说两句吧...